How can organizations use virtual reality technology to foster a sense of community and collaboration among employees working in different locations or departments?
Organizations can use virtual reality technology to create immersive virtual environments where employees from different locations or departments can interact and collaborate in real-time. This can help foster a sense of community by allowing employees to feel like they are physically present with one another, despite being geographically separated. Virtual reality can also be used to facilitate team-building activities, training sessions, and meetings, enhancing communication and collaboration among employees. Additionally, organizations can use virtual reality to create virtual offices or workspaces where employees can work together on projects, fostering a sense of belonging and teamwork.
